Links without the ‘nofollow’ tag – To fight spammy links, search engines introduced what is known as the “nofollow link”. Regarding off-page SEO, links that carry the ‘nofollow’ tag are ignored by search engines and do not influence your rankings. Links with relevant anchor text – Anchor text is the text description of a link.
